type
TTimerID = record
hWnd: THandle;
nIDEvent: UINT_PTR;
end;
{ TQtTimerEx }
TQtTimerEx = class(TQtObject)
private
FTimerHook: QTimer_hookH;
FWidgetHook: QObject_hookH;
FCallbackFunc: TTimerNotify;
FID: UINT_PTR;
FHandle: THandle;
FControl: TWinControl;
public
constructor Create(hWnd: THandle; nIDEvent: UINT_PTR; TimerFunc: TTimerNotify);
destructor Destroy; override;
procedure AttachEvents; override;
procedure DetachEvents; override;
procedure signalWidgetDestroyed; cdecl;
procedure signalTimeout; cdecl;
public
function EventFilter(Sender: QObjectH; Event: QEventH): Boolean; cdecl; override;
procedure Start(Interval: Integer);
procedure Stop;
end;
{ TTimerList }
TTimerList = class
private
FMap: TMap;
public
constructor Create;
destructor Destroy; override;
procedure Delete(hWnd: THandle; nIDEvent: UINT_PTR);
function Find(hWnd: THandle; nIDEvent: UINT_PTR): TQtTimerEx;
function Get(hWnd: THandle; nIDEvent: UINT_PTR; NotifyFunc: TTimerNotify): TQtTimerEx;
end;
TQtWidgetSetHack = Class(TWidgetSet)
private
App: QApplicationH;
end;
var
FTimerList: TTimerList;
{ TQtTimerEx }
constructor TQtTimerEx.Create(hWnd: THandle; nIDEvent: UINT_PTR; TimerFunc: TTimerNotify);
var
AName: WideString;
begin
inherited Create;
FDeleteLater := True;
FCallbackFunc := TimerFunc;
FID := nIDEvent;
FControl := FindControl(hWnd);
FHandle := hWnd;
if hWnd <> 0 then
begin
FWidgetHook := QObject_hook_create(TQtWidget(hWnd).TheObject);
QObject_hook_hook_destroyed(FWidgetHook, @signalWidgetDestroyed);
end;
//very big ultra extreme hack to get the app from QtWidgetset
TheObject := QTimer_create(TQtWidgetSetHack(QtWidgetSet).App);
AName := 'tqttimerex';
QObject_setObjectName(TheObject, @AName);
AttachEvents;
end;
destructor TQtTimerEx.Destroy;
begin
if FWidgetHook <> nil then
QObject_hook_destroy(FWidgetHook);
inherited Destroy;
end;
procedure TQtTimerEx.AttachEvents;
begin
FTimerHook := QTimer_hook_create(QTimerH(TheObject));
QTimer_hook_hook_timeout(FTimerHook, @signalTimeout);
inherited AttachEvents;
end;
procedure TQtTimerEx.DetachEvents;
begin
QTimer_stop(QTimerH(TheObject));
if FTimerHook <> nil then
QTimer_hook_destroy(FTimerHook);
inherited DetachEvents;
end;
procedure TQtTimerEx.signalWidgetDestroyed; cdecl;
begin
Stop;
FTimerList.Delete(FHandle, FID);
Destroy;
end;
procedure TQtTimerEx.signalTimeout; cdecl;
begin
if Assigned(FCallbackFunc) then
FCallbackFunc(FID)
else if Assigned(FControl) then
begin
if ([csLoading, csDestroying] * FControl.ComponentState = []) and not
(csDestroyingHandle in FControl.ControlState) then
begin
LCLSendTimerMsg(FControl, FID, 0);
end;
end
else
begin
//orphan timer. Stop.
//todo: better to remove from the list?
Stop;
end;
end;
function TQtTimerEx.EventFilter(Sender: QObjectH; Event: QEventH): Boolean; cdecl;
begin
Result := False;
QEvent_accept(Event);
end;
procedure TQtTimerEx.Start(Interval: Integer);
begin
QTimer_start(QTimerH(TheObject), Interval);
end;
procedure TQtTimerEx.Stop;
begin
QTimer_stop(QTimerH(TheObject));
end;
function KillTimer(hWnd: THandle; nIDEvent: UINT_PTR): Boolean;
var
TimerObject: TQtTimerEx;
begin
Result := True;
TimerObject := FTimerList.Find(hWnd, nIDEvent);
if TimerObject <> nil then
begin
// DebugLn('KillTimer HWnd: %d ID: %d TimerObject: %d',[hWnd, nIDEvent, PtrInt(TimerObject)]);
TimerObject.Stop;
end;
end;
function SetTimer(hWnd: THandle; nIDEvent: UINT_PTR; uElapse: LongWord; lpTimerFunc: TTimerNotify): UINT_PTR;
var
TimerObject: TQtTimerEx;
begin
TimerObject := FTimerList.Get(hWnd, nIDEvent, lpTimerFunc);
try
TimerObject.Start(uElapse);
if hWnd = 0 then
Result := PtrInt(TimerObject)
else
Result := nIdEvent;
except
Result := 0;
end;
//DebugLn('SetTimer HWnd: %d ID: %d TimerObject: %d',[hWnd, nIDEvent, PtrInt(TimerObject)]);
end;
function TTimerList.Get(hWnd: THandle; nIDEvent: UINT_PTR; NotifyFunc: TTimerNotify): TQtTimerEx;
var
AID: TTimerID;
begin
AID.hWnd := hWnd;
AID.nIDEvent := nIDEvent;
with FMap do
begin
if HasId(AID) then
begin
// DebugLn('Reset timer for HWnd: %d ID: %d AID: %d', [hWnd, ID, AID]);
GetData(AID, Result);
Result.FCallbackFunc := NotifyFunc;
end
else
begin
// DebugLn('Create timer for HWnd: %d ID: %d AID: %d', [hWnd, ID, AID]);
Result := TQtTimerEx.Create(hWnd, nIDEvent, NotifyFunc);
if hWnd = 0 then
begin
AID.nIDEvent := PtrUInt(Result);
Result.FID := PtrUInt(Result);
end;
Add(AID, Result);
end;
end;
end;
constructor TTimerList.Create;
begin
FMap := TMap.Create({$ifdef CPU64}itu16{$else}itu8{$endif}, SizeOf(TQtTimerEx));
end;
destructor TTimerList.Destroy;
var
Iterator: TMapIterator;
TimerObject: TQtTimerEx;
begin
Iterator := TMapIterator.Create(FMap);
with Iterator do
begin
while not EOM do
begin
GetData(TimerObject);
TimerObject.Free;
Next;
end;
Destroy;
end;
FMap.Destroy;
end;
procedure TTimerList.Delete(hWnd: THandle; nIDEvent: UINT_PTR);
var
TimerID: TTimerID;
begin
TimerID.hWnd := hWnd;
TimerID.nIDEvent := nIDEvent;
FMap.Delete(TimerID);
end;
function TTimerList.Find(hWnd: THandle; nIDEvent: UINT_PTR): TQtTimerEx;
var
DataPtr: ^TQtTimerEx;
TimerID: TTimerID;
begin
Result := nil;
TimerID.hWnd := hWnd;
TimerID.nIDEvent := nIDEvent;
// DebugLn('GetTimerObject for HWnd: %d ID: %d AID: %d', [hWnd, nIDEvent, TimerID]);
DataPtr := FMap.GetDataPtr(TimerID);
if DataPtr <> nil then
Result := DataPtr^;
end;
